This game is a great party game for anyone who is a movie fan. There are 8 very different rounds that each have a variety of questions, from movie quotes and naming titles of movies to interseting historical facts.
The coolest part of the game is that it is completed played on the DVD player itself and doesn't require a game board or any game systems. The game tracks your score for you, so you don't need paper or the ability to add. The biggest downfall that nobody seems to mention is that this game can only be played 3 times!! $20 for a game that can only be played 3 times is a little pricey. When you put the DVD in your player, the game asks you to select a game that you haven't played before and gives you 3 choices. The game is not like some of the other movie trivia games that shuffle their questions, it is the exact same game everytime. Final Verdict: A great party game that has trivia for everyone! Buy it used and then sell it or give it to a friend after you play the 3 games on the disk.

This is a great party game, and if you love movies you will have a blast playing this game with a group of friends. While given clues about various films, players divided into two teams will shout out movie titles, or landmarks, or movie stars. The game is simple to play, and the built in instructions and score-keeping are real time savers...there is no gameboard to deal with, dice to lose, or pawns to move so that is a real plus. But the main drawback to this game is that once you play the 3 games per dvd, you won't go back to play it again because the questions asked on each game never change. Maybe if they combined the games on all 4 disks available onto one dvd you would go back and play again....because then it's not as likely you would remember the answers, but with only 8 rounds per game and 10 or less questions or clues per round it's hard not to remember what the correct answers are. The variety of films covered isn't bad, but folks who enjoy older films of the 30's, 40's and 50's won't find too many questions pertaining to films made prior to 1970, and horror fans will not find any questions pertaining to thier blood soaked genre. If you can find a copy of this game used, or for around $10 you should pick it up. But $20 seems a little steep for a game that will played and put away until forgotten.

My friends and I, all in college, are major movie buffs, so when another friend told me about the game, I was eager to try it. Some parts are tough, but with the team setup of the game, it seems to even out. Favourite rounds were Still Crazy: a round where scenes are built piece by piece, a word association round: 6 clues are provided and the idea is to name the movie, and the quotes round, of course! The hardest rounds were the matching and the trivia rounds. Still, we had great fun. Its better if the teams are evenly matched, then its more fun. The main objection I have is that in the 8 rounds, many of the movies are dated and overused. There are great ones, though...Rain Man, Cast Away!! Also, this game is linear in progression, there is no variation in the order of the questions. Scoring uses the honour system. There are 3 games, each lasting around 45 minutes at the very fastest, its the same as the cost of a regular DVD and is much more fun with lots of people.
